REVIEW BY BEN STEVENS
Is it senior team or bust for Carlos Sainz? Is Max
Verstappen leaving for Ferrari? Is Daniel Ricciardo
retiring?!
Funnily enough, it’s only the one we’ve heard
directly from the horse’s mouth that we can rule out
entirely, the other two – who knows?
Red Bull advisor and lost-Scooby Doo villain
Helmut Markko was adamant on Friday that Sainz
would be in a Toro Rosso next year, but if reports are to
be believed and Verstappen is on his way out, things
could change.
What makes this particularly tricky to dissect
is all the potential misdirection going on. Dutch
commentator Olav Mol is claiming the Verstappen
rumour actually came from the Sainz camp, having
fed it to Spanish newspaper Marca, which was
subsequently picked-up by The Independent, which if
true, is a hell of a piece of skulduggery. In any case,
this is a story that seems far from over…
